In line with article 12.1 of the constitution of the All Progressives Congress (APC), Reps member, Bunmi Tunji-Ojo was nominated as the House of Representatives member of the highest decision making body of the party, National Executive Committee (NEC) representing the South West Zone.
The Constitution made provision for “one member of the House of Representatives from each geopolitical zone of the country, who is a member of the party, to be nominated by members of the House of Representatives from such zone.”
He will be joining other five (5) members of the Green chamber from the other five (5) geopolitical zones.
